We had birdseed. Rose petals are a neat idea too...sea grape leaves, to adapt to the theme? Of course, if you were on the actual beach, there would undoubtedly be a little kid who would pick up SAND and throw it at you!

As a former bride myself (yuck, that sounds like I'm divorced or something ), let me mention something that no one seems to think of. That stuff HURTS!! Rice or birdseed will sting your exposed skin, get in your hair, and find its way into every undergarment you have on and proceed to itch and irritate you the entire rest of the day! When my husband adjusted his tux and shirt the tiniest bit after we went back inside the church for pictures, a deluge of the stuff ***e pouring out all over the carpet in front of the altar. Moral of the story: shake out, outside!
